1. Maintaining a Comfortable Environment

During winter, aim to keep the room temperature between 65-75°F (18-24°C). Use a bird-safe heater or heat lamp to provide a consistent, warm environment. This helps your budgies stay cozy and minimizes the impact of cold weather.

2. Ensuring Access to Unfrozen Water

Frequent water checks are crucial. Consider using a heated water dish or changing water more often to prevent freezing. Hydration is vital for your budgies\’ overall well-being, especially in colder weather.

3. Providing Extra Bedding and Nesting Material

Offer additional layers of bedding, such as paper or safe, non-toxic fabrics, to create a warm and comfortable resting place for your budgies. This extra insulation helps them retain body heat during the colder nights.

4. Protecting Against Drafts

Place the cage away from windows, doors, and vents to avoid direct exposure to cold drafts. Covering part of the cage with a blanket or cage cover can provide additional insulation. This precaution helps your budgies maintain a stable and comfortable environment.

5. Monitoring Your Budgies\’ Health

Pay close attention to your budgies for any signs of cold stress. Watch for behaviors like fluffed feathers, shivering, or reduced activity. If you notice any signs of illness or discomfort, seek immediate veterinary attention.

6. Providing Nutritional Support

Winter can be a time when budgies require extra nutrition. Consider offering warm, nutrient-rich foods like cooked grains and vegetables. Supplementing their diet with additional vitamins or mineral-rich treats can also provide a health boost.

7. Engaging in Mental Stimulation

With the colder weather, budgies may spend more time indoors. Provide stimulating toys, puzzles, and interactive activities to keep them mentally engaged. This helps prevent boredom and supports their overall mental well-being.

8. Maintaining a Consistent Routine

Sticking to a regular feeding schedule and providing a stable environment offers a sense of security for your budgies. Predictable routines can help alleviate stress and contribute to their overall well-being.
